Yeah yeah: it "works". The ride height is lower, the wheelbase is shorter and the leverage on the bushing is reduced, so it's a little more stable. The thing is...you gotta use 76mm wheels or so if you don't want to be scraping the hanger on rocks and etc...
I have to say, I think the coolest way to lower a Revenge is the drop-throughs that Longboard Larry (anyone else, too?) has done. I haven't ridden one, but they look like quite the ticket. I have ridden the Bustin Complex with Revenges (2's) and it's "sorta effectively lowered" because of the nose/tail kicks where the trucks mount. That's a great setup!
